Bingo Operators Unite in June
Online casino bingo gambling is arguably one of the fastest growing sectors of
the internet gambling industry. Internet bingo sites are growing at exponential
rates, and there are enough internet bingo operators to justify an Online Bingo
Summit – and surprisingly this is the third of these summits. The online casinos
gambling industry has several annual summits all over the world to discuss new
technologies and the future of the industry, but because internet bingo is a
newly popular internet activity, this third annual Bingo Summit will be bigger
than ever before – and sponsored by the top online casinos bingo software
developers, Parlay Entertainment, Inc.
Parlay Entertainment is a prominent software developer for the industry, and by
sponsoring the event, the company is able to expand and reaffirm the Parlay
brand and successful online casinos bingo gambling platform. As this year’s
event gears up, Parlay has announced that it has actually signed a two-year
contract with Bullet Business, the company organizing and presenting the Bingo
Summit. Parlay has actually sponsored the event for all three years that it has
run, so it looks like the company plans has plans of longevity in the industry.
As for why Parlay has chosen to sponsor the event even though the company is
going through some financial difficulties, the online casino bingo company’s
European Managing Director, Steve Cook, notes, "The Bingo Summit has become a
must-attend event where the whole industry gathers to discuss the many new and
exciting opportunities ahead. New market and media channels are emerging across
Europe and this year bingo is set to fulfill its mass market potential both
online and on TV."
Cook also notes, "Online bingo is the fastest growing sector in i-gaming and
continues to expand at an impressive pace." The online casinos gambling
companies attending the Bingo Summit all share a common vision – the continued
expansion of internet bingo into new and emerging markets. This year’s summit
takes place June 17-18, 2008 in London. |
